A long-awaited era in Apple’s health history is here

The Apple Watch is now being leveraged to help manage Parkinson's disease, a degenerative brain disorder that affects as many as a million Americans.

Over the past year, the FDA has cleared three Apple Watch apps from developers to track the tremors and dyskinesia associated with Parkinson’s — work that began nearly a decade ago. 

The goal is to help inform treatment decisions for people and providers, but there’s a long slog ahead before doctors and the broader health system can be convinced the tools are worth using.

This paper delves into the relationship between Emotional Intelligence (EI) and innovation in organizations.

It systematically reviews existing literature to explore how EI, encompassing self-awareness, self-control, empathy, and social skills, can drive creativity and innovation.

It also highlights research gaps, proposing directions for future studies to further understand how organizations can leverage EI to foster a creative and innovative environment.

1. The paper emphasizes the evolving needs of customers and society, necessitating organizations to be emotionally intelligent to adapt their strategies and remain relevant. EI helps in understanding and managing the emotions of internal and external stakeholders, improving the quality of innovations.

2. It discusses different models and definitions of EI, such as the ability model, trait model, and mixed model, each providing a unique perspective on how individuals can understand, manage, and utilize emotions effectively in organizational contexts.

3. The paper identifies a gap in the literature regarding a systematic review that converges the fields of EI and creativity and innovation, motivating the current study. It aims to help organizations identify strategies to build EI competencies that promote innovation and creativity.

4. The study also explores the negative aspects of EI, such as higher stress levels in emotionally intelligent people and a tendency to avoid risks and maintain the status quo, which might be counterproductive to innovation.

A standard neural net optimized for compositional skills, can mimic human systematic generalization (SG) in a head-to-head comparison.

SG is the algebraic ability to understand and produce novel combinations from known components. For instance, once a child learns how to "skip", they understand how to "skip twice" or "skip around an obstacle."

The accuracy and reliability of responses generated by a chatbot, specifically ChatGPT, to medical queries posed by physicians

The study involved 33 physicians across 17 specialties who generated 284 medical questions, which were then answered by the chatbot. The physicians evaluated the chatbot’s responses based on accuracy and completeness. The study aimed to assess the potential of natural language processing tools like chatbots in enhancing the accessibility of medical information for health professionals and patients, and their suitability in clinical settings.

1. The chatbot predominantly generated accurate information in response to diverse medical queries as judged by academic physician specialists. The median accuracy score was 5.5 on a scale of 1 to 6, where 6 indicates a completely correct response.

2. The chatbot’s responses were found to be comprehensive, with a median completeness score of 3 on a scale of 1 to 3, where 3 indicates a complete and comprehensive response.

3. The study found that the chatbot’s accuracy improved over time and between two different versions of the chatbot (GPT-3.5 and GPT-4).

4. The chatbot showed substantial improvement when re-queried with questions that initially received inaccurate answers.

5. The study also revealed that the chatbot had limitations and there were areas where further research and model development were needed to correct inaccuracies.

The Drake Star Q3'23 Global Gaming Report is out

Q3 saw gaming M&A activity from some of the biggest strategics and Q4 started on a great note with the era-defining gaming deal in Microsoft / Activision finally closing.

Highlights include:

1. Tencent leads the way with five deals during the quarter including the Techland acquisition which is among the top 3 largest deals of the year. Other notable buyers were Playtika (Innplay Labs and YoudaGames), Goldman Sachs, General Atlantic and the LEGO Group (Kahoot!), Take-Two Interactive, Behaviour Interactive, Capcom and Roblox.

2. $1B in 185 private financing rounds, an increase in value from Q2'23. Notable raises were Candivore ($100M), Second Dinner ($90M), Story Protocol ($54M), Futureverse ($54M) and Inworld AI ($50M).

3. BITKRAFT Ventures led the VC league table, followed by Andreessen Horowitz, Play Ventures, Griffin Gaming Partners and vgames.

4. Tencent, Sony, Take-Two Interactive and Savvy Games Group / Scopely are expected to be the most active buyers.
